Output 8eac01cd7a83108a4cd65b77bd9ab1c974f005eeedff83273214397bbc0651a7:47

value
585327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d25bdaa475afb7a708d4754b363118ea551396c OP_EQUAL
address
3ABXyfbZNN82rqFuSfmn76Dh2ybXhdRcsF
transaction
8eac01cd7a83108a4cd65b77bd9ab1c974f005eeedff83273214397bbc0651a7
spent
true